What Is Implantation Bleeding?
Understanding the Context
Implantation bleeding occurs when the fertilized egg attaches to the uterine lining, usually 10 to 14 days after conception. This tiny event can cause a faint spill of blood, often light pink or brown, and typically lasts less than 24 hours. Unlike a full period, it’s usually much lighter and less heavy.
How Does It Compare to a Normal Period?
At a glance, implantation bleeding and a period might seem interchangeable—both involve bleeding, cramping, and timing variations. But the differences are both surprising and key:
| Feature | Implantation Bleeding | Menstrual Period |
|-------------------------|-------------------------------------------|---------------------------------------|
| Timing | Occurs very early—about 10–14 days post-conception | Follows your regular cycle (typically 28 days) |
| Color | Light pink, brown, or faint red | Varies (bright red, dark red, or brown) |
| Flow/Heaviness | Very light spotting; usually no pad/pant liner needed | Moderate to heavy bleeding requiring sanitary products |
| Duration | Usually lasts less than 1–2 days | Typically lasts 3–7 days |
| Associated Symptoms | Mild cramping, possible early pregnancy signs (e.g., breast tenderness) | Stronger cramps, bloating, mood swings |
| Pregnancy Indicator | May signal early pregnancy | Occurs in the absence of pregnancy |
